Output 81d8df6324fa1b95fbba7f8328681487a83d2f1595d1d22de7197a0c05fe8cc5:1

value
11688778
script pubkey
OP_0 OP_PUSHBYTES_20 806738f2902712cf925953f5ecd2c9e1287d64b9
address
bc1qspnn3u5syufvlyje2067e5kfuy586e9en48rjh
transaction
81d8df6324fa1b95fbba7f8328681487a83d2f1595d1d22de7197a0c05fe8cc5
confirmations
232753
spent
true